/* This file is part of the Project Athena Zephyr Notification System.
* It contains code for "zshutdown_notify", a utility called by
* shutdown(8) to do Zephyr notification on shutdown.
*
* Created by: C. Anthony Della Fera
*
* $Id$
*
* Copyright (c) 1987, 1993 by the Massachusetts Institute of Technology.
* For copying and distribution information, see the file
* "mit-copyright.h".
*/
#include <sysdep.h>
#include <zephyr/mit-copyright.h>
#include <zephyr/zephyr.h>
#include <sys/socket.h>
#include <netdb.h>
#include <arpa/nameser.h>
#ifndef lint
static const char rcsid_zshutdown_notify_c[] =
"$Id$";
#endif
#define N_KIND UNSAFE
#define N_CLASS "FILSRV"
#define N_OPCODE "SHUTDOWN"
#define N_DEF_FORMAT "From $sender:\n@bold(Shutdown message from $1 at $time)\n@center(System going down, message is:)\n\n$2\n\n@center(@bold($3))"
#define N_FIELD_CNT 3
#ifdef HAVE_KRB4
#define SVC_NAME "rcmd"
#endif
/*
* Standard warning strings appended as extra fields to
* the message body.
*/
static char warning[] = "Please detach any filesystems you may have\nattached from this host by typing detach -host %s";
/*ARGSUSED*/
int
main(int argc,
char *argv[])
{
ZNotice_t notice;
struct hostent *hp;
int retval;
char hostname[NS_MAXDNAME];
char msgbuff[BUFSIZ], message[Z_MAXPKTLEN], *ptr;
char scratch[BUFSIZ];
char *msg[N_FIELD_CNT];
#ifdef HAVE_KRB4
char tkt_filename[MAXPATHLEN];
char rlm[REALM_SZ];
char hn2[NS_MAXDNAME];
char *cp;
#endif
if (gethostname(hostname, sizeof(hostname)) < 0) {
com_err(argv[0], errno, "while finding hostname");
exit(1);
}
if ((hp = gethostbyname(hostname)) != NULL)
(void) strcpy(hostname, hp->h_name);
msg[0] = hostname;
msg[1] = message;
sprintf(scratch, warning, hostname);
msg[2] = scratch;
#ifdef HAVE_KRB4
(void) sprintf(tkt_filename, "/tmp/tkt_zshut_%d", getpid());
krb_set_tkt_string(tkt_filename);
cp = krb_get_phost(hostname);
if (cp)
(void) strcpy(hn2, cp);
else {
fprintf(stderr, "%s: can't figure out canonical hostname\n",argv[0]);
exit(1);
}
retval = krb_get_lrealm(rlm, 1);
if (retval) {
fprintf(stderr, "%s: can't get local realm: %s\n",
argv[0], krb_get_err_text(retval));
exit(1);
}
retval = krb_get_svc_in_tkt(SVC_NAME, hn2, rlm,
SERVER_SERVICE, SERVER_INSTANCE, 1,
(char *)KEYFILE);
if (retval) {
fprintf(stderr, "%s: can't get tickets: %s\n",
argv[0], krb_get_err_text(retval));
exit(1);
}
#endif
if ((retval = ZInitialize()) != ZERR_NONE) {
com_err(argv[0], retval, "while initializing");
exit(1);
}
ptr = message;
for (;;) {
if (!fgets(msgbuff, sizeof(msgbuff), stdin))
break;
if ((strlen(msgbuff) + (ptr - message)) > Z_MAXPKTLEN){
break;
}
(void) strcpy(ptr, msgbuff);
ptr += strlen(ptr);
}
(void) memset((char *)&notice, 0, sizeof(notice));
notice.z_kind = N_KIND;
notice.z_port = 0;
notice.z_charset = ZCHARSET_UNKNOWN;
notice.z_class = N_CLASS;
notice.z_class_inst = hostname;
notice.z_opcode = N_OPCODE;
notice.z_sender = 0;
notice.z_message_len = 0;
notice.z_recipient = "";
notice.z_default_format = N_DEF_FORMAT;
retval = ZSendList(&notice, msg, N_FIELD_CNT, ZAUTH);
#ifdef HAVE_KRB4
(void) dest_tkt();
#endif
if (retval != ZERR_NONE) {
com_err(argv[0], retval, "while sending notice");
exit(1);
}
return 0;
}
